diagram:
  title: "生成 AI エージェント開発沼のサイクル"
  style:
    character: "simple_editorial_cute"
    tone: "light_like_original"
    line: "soft_round"
    shading: "flat_minimal"
    palette: "muted_editorial"
    background: "light_beige_or_white"

  rule:
    first_character_only: "最初の人物だけ違う"
    others_same_character: "その他はすべて同じ人物"
    anxiety_requires_tech_terms: true
    dialogue_tone: "元の図の短く軽い言い回しを維持する"

layout:
  intro_track: "上部は直線(左から右)で、その後ループに合流するように下降する"
  loop_track: "ループ(環状)として配置され、矢印は円周に沿って時計回りに湾曲する"

nodes:
  # ===== Upper Section: Straight Introduction =====
  - id: A
    zone: "intro"
    position: "upper_left"
    actor: "別の人物(シニアエンジニア)"
    visual: "ノートパソコンを指差している"
    item: "AI エージェントのデモ画面"
    says: "これで君も幸せになれるよ"
    arrow_to: { id: B, shape: "straight", direction: "right" }

  - id: B
    zone: "intro"
    position: "upper_center"
    actor: "主人公(同じ人物)"
    visual: "軽く手を振っている"
    says: "簡単なエージェントでも..."
    arrow_to: { id: C, shape: "straight", direction: "right" }

  - id: C
    zone: "intro"
    position: "upper_right"
    actor: "主人公(同じ人物)"
    visual: "サンプルコードを実行している"
    item: "LangChain / CrewAI サンプル"
    arrow_to: { id: D, shape: "straight", direction: "down" }

  # ===== D: Awakening Point =====
  - id: D
    zone: "connector"
    position: "right_outer_before_loop"
    actor: "主人公(同じ人物)"
    visual:
      face: "目を大きく見開いている(かわいい)"
      effect: "小さなひらめきの線"
      posture: "前かがみになっている"
    state: "覚醒"
    says: "エージェント、これはヤバい..."
    micro_text: "(ここで覚醒)"
    arrow_to:
      id: E
      shape: "gentle_curve"
      direction: "down_into_ring"

  # ===== Loop Start (Must rotate from here) =====
  - id: E
    zone: "loop"
    position: "loop_right_upper"
    actor: "主人公(同じ人物)"
    visual: "頭を抱えている(かわいい)"
    state: "イライラ開始"
    says: "イライラ"
    thought_terms:
      - "プロンプト設計"
      - "ツール選択"
      - "メモリ設計"
    thought_text: "意図した通りに動かない..."
    arrow_to: { id: F, shape: "curved_along_ring", direction: "clockwise" }

  - id: F
    zone: "loop"
    position: "loop_right_lower"
    actor: "主人公(同じ人物)"
    visual: "コードとログに囲まれている"
    state: "イライラが募る"
    says: "イライラした状態"
    callout: "ループ!暴走!ハルシネーション!"
    thought_terms:
      - "RAG"
      - "関数呼び出し"
      - "ツール利用"
    arrow_to: { id: G, shape: "curved_along_ring", direction: "clockwise" }

  - id: G
    zone: "loop"
    position: "loop_bottom"
    actor: "主人公(同じ人物)"
    visual: "付箋と図で覆われている"
    says: "徐々に体が耐性をつけ、使用量が増えていく"
    items:
      - "エージェントアーキテクチャ図"
      - "役割分担メモ"
      - "状態遷移フロー"
    arrow_to: { id: H, shape: "curved_along_ring", direction: "clockwise" }

  - id: H
    zone: "loop"
    position: "loop_left_lower"
    actor: "主人公(同じ人物)"
    visual: "うまくいく、小さなガッツポーズ"
    state: "一時的な満足"
    says: "欲求が一時的に満たされる"
    arrow_to: { id: I, shape: "curved_along_ring", direction: "clockwise" }

  - id: I
    zone: "loop"
    position: "loop_left_upper"
    actor: "主人公(同じ人物)"
    visual: "再び考えている"
    state: "執着/思考占有"
    says: "エージェントについて考えている"
インフォグラフィック / 教育ビジュアル - AI エージェント開発の「沼」ダイアグラムプロンプト
1
0
0

AI エージェント開発で行き詰まるという循環的な性質を示す「Swamp」図(人気のインターネットミーム形式)を生成するための、Nano Banana Pro 用の詳細な JSON ベースのプロンプト。このプロンプトは、図の構造、スタイル(シンプルでかわいいエディトリアル)、レイアウト(時計回りのループにつながるまっすぐな導入トラック)、およびキャラクター、ビジュアル、対話/思考の用語を含む特定のノードを定義します。

Language
EnglishDeutschEspañolFrançais日本語한국어Português中文
Created7 months ago
Last updated23 days ago
Creator

Services with a clipboard icon will copy the prompt to your clipboard first.

Version History
Prompt documentation
Comments (0)
Please log in to leave a comment.

Be the first to comment

to start the conversation.

Related Prompts
EnglishDeutschEspañolFrançais日本語한국어Português中文

A detailed JSON-based prompt for Nano Banana Pro to generate a 'Swamp' diagram (a popular internet meme format) illustrating the circular nature of getting stuck in AI Agent development. The prompt defines the diagram's structure, style (simple, cute editorial), layout (straight intro track leading into a clockwise loop), and specific nodes with characters, visuals, and dialogue/thought terms.

0
0
0

EnglishDeutschEspañolFrançais日本語한국어Português中文

A prompt designed to generate an image of a vintage United States patent document from the late 1800s. It specifies details like precise technical drawings, handwritten annotations, aged paper texture, foxing stains, an embossed seal, and a wax stamp, making it ideal for historical or archival aesthetics.

0
0
0

EnglishDeutschEspañolFrançais日本語한국어Português中文

A highly technical, structured prompt for an image-to-image identity swap task, generating a 4x4 black and white grid. The prompt instructs the model to replace the identity in the reference grid image with a new target identity while strictly preserving the original poses, expressions, layout, and wardrobe (suit-and-tie).

0
0
0

EnglishDeutschEspañolFrançais日本語한국어Português中文

A complex prompt for generating a realistic Vogue magazine cover-style fashion portrait using an uploaded face for strict identity preservation. The scene depicts the subject winking and making a heart gesture while surrounded by paparazzi cameras and smartphones, emphasizing high-fashion styling, studio lighting, and 85mm lens bokeh.

0
0
0

EnglishDeutschEspañolFrançais日本語한국어Português中文

A prompt for generating a photorealistic image where the subject's identity and outfit are preserved from a reference image, but the background is replaced with a chaotic, real behind-the-scenes set from the movie 'Léon: The Professional'. The subject, Léon, and Mathilda are taking a selfie together amid crew members and filming equipment.

0
0
0

EnglishDeutschEspañolFrançais日本語한국어Português中文

A structured JSON prompt for Nano Banana Pro defining a high-fidelity face swap task. The instructions emphasize seamless, ultra-realistic integration, preserving the source identity, matching skin tone and expression, and maintaining the original background and composition details.

0
0
0